I use an MP3 player quite often, although there are benefits to not using them.

First, more and more competitions are banning them, so if you train with one all the time then can't use it during a race, you could feel "lost" during the race.

Second, you can focus more on your body and the task at hand without one.

Third, and most important, safety. For example, the distraction could lead to you getting hit by a car or getting mugged.
